site stats

Binary tree algorithm in c++

WebBinary Search Algorithm can be implemented in two ways which are discussed below. … WebHow is a preorder traversal found for a binary tree? Add the current node to the list, and then run DFS on all child nodes of the current node from left to right. Run DFS on the left node, add the current node to the list, and then run DFS on the right node.

C++ Binary Tree Path finding - Stack Overflow

WebBreadth–first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a ‘search key’) and explores the neighbor nodes … WebJul 25, 2024 · To create a BST in C++, we need to modify our TreeNode class in the preceding binary tree discussion, Building a binary tree ADT. We need to add the Parent properties so that we can track the parent of … hillary slips in india https://swheat.org

Binary Tree Data Structure - GeeksforGeeks

WebFeb 15, 2024 · You can utilize the following code to implement a binary tree in data structures. Code: //A c++ Program to implement a binary tree in data structures #include using namespace std; //A structure to create node struct Node { int data; struct Node* left; struct Node* right; // A constructor to the struct node WebSep 30, 2024 · Data Structure & Algorithm Classes (Live) System Designs (Live) DevOps(Live) Explore More Survive Courses; For Students. Interview Formulation Course; Data Natural (Live) GATE CS & IT 2024;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Advanced is Python; Explore Other Self-Paced … WebMay 6, 2024 · C/C++ Program for Binary Tree to Binary Search Tree Conversion. … hillary silk screen printer -williams

Why does the C++ STL not provide any "tree" containers?

Category:Map Reduce Algorithm for Binary Search Tree in Data Structure

Tags:Binary tree algorithm in c++

Binary tree algorithm in c++

Basic Operations on Binary Tree with Implementations

WebApr 5, 2024 · Another Algorithm for calculating the height of a Binary Tree. Start from the root and move up the tree in level order. Push null into the Q after initialising it with an empty queue, a configurable depth, and a push root. While loop should be run till Q is not empty. Q's front piece can be stored after being popped out. WebReading time: 25 minutes Coding time: 40 minutes. In this article, we have explored how to implement Binary Tree Data Structure in C++ including all different operations like traversing, inserting and deleting. We have used …

Binary tree algorithm in c++

Did you know?

http://cslibrary.stanford.edu/110/BinaryTrees.html

WebApr 12, 2024 · Basic Operations on Binary Tree with Implementations. The tree is a … WebApr 6, 2024 · A binary search tree (BST) is a special type of tree data structure that allows for efficient searching and sorting of data. Each node has two children, a left child and a right child, and the nodes that make up the BST are arranged in a hierarchical pattern. A data element is also stored in each node.

WebMar 21, 2024 · Binary Search Tree is a node-based binary tree data structure which has … WebApr 6, 2024 · Map Reduce is an algorithm that can be used to search for an element in a …

WebMar 8, 2024 · This is for college so the requirements are as follows: Take your code from …

WebBinary Trees. by Nick Parlante. This article introduces the basic concepts of binary trees, and thenworks through a series of practice problems with solution code in C/C++and Java. Binary trees have an elegant recursive … hillary signing newsweek coversWebBinary search tree in C++ is defined as a data structure that consists of the node-based … hillary sleep calculatorWebJun 14, 2024 · Given a binary tree and a node in the binary tree, find Levelorder successor of the given node. That is, the node that appears after the given node in the level order traversal of the tree. Note: The task is not just to print the data of the node, you have to return the complete node from the tree. Examples : hillary simms of torbayWebA Binary search tree is a type of binary tree in which all the nodes having lesser values than the root node are kept on the left subtree, and similarly, the values greater than the root node are kept on the right subtree. How much time does inserting an element take in BST? smart cash cryptocurrency coin newsWebJun 14,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& … smart cash ersteWebNov 20, 2012 · It's never going to be pretty enough, unless one does some backtracking … smart cash extraWebMar 15, 2024 · Binary trees can be used to implement searching algorithms, such as in binary search trees which can be used to quickly find an element in a sorted list. Binary trees can be used to implement sorting algorithms, such as in heap sort which uses a binary … A Binary Tree is a full binary tree if every node has 0 or 2 children. The following … 2. The Maximum number of nodes in a binary tree of height ‘h’ is 2 h – 1:. Note: … smart cash platinum plus